Lot 122

A George III Royal Navy Battle of Trafalgar interest, silver pair case pocket watch, comprising a signed Charles Bennett cream enamel dial with numeral indices, outer chapter ring, case apporox 42mm, movement marked Geo Edmonds London, movement number 3996, case marked London 1788, with outer case also marked London 1788, along with service papers to case, together with a gilt metal fob chain, ley and agate gold set seal, 'Si Tu Ne Changes Je Ne Tourne'  translates to 'If you do not change I will turn' with wax seal print and wooden case Provenance: nestled within the silver outer case is a late 19th century handwritten note, which reads: ‘This watch belonged to my Gt Grandfather, Capt. Charles Bennett who was on the Tonnant at Trafalgar. The seal was given him by a French Officer on Algesiras. James H Watts 1897’. According to historical records, there was a Lieutenant Charles Bennett on HMS Tonnant during the Battle of Trafalgar.  Tonnant captured the 74 gun frigate, Algesiras during the battle, losing 26 officers and men, and 50 officers and men wounded. Lt Bennett was the officer in charge of the ‘prize’, and with 50 men under his command, he at one point held around 270 French officers and men as prisoners.  When the note refers to a ‘Capt Charles Bennett’ it’s assumed that this was a rank that he held later in his career, post Trafalgar era. general condition: chip to dial  Note: regarding watches/pocket watches please note movements untested, functionality untested, for more information request a condition report with specific questions or please view in person

Lot 50

An early 19th century hardstone gold seal signet ring, comprising a six petaled flower motif of banded agate, bezel set, the intaglio carved with the family crest for Sir William Earle Welby of Welby and Denton, Lincolnshire, reads' The family motto ‘Per Ignem Per Gladium’ translates as ‘By Fire, By Sword’ width approx 13mm, tapered shoulders, size K, unmarked, probably 18ct gold, total gross weight approx 4gms  along with Portable Antiquities Scheme unique ID- DENO-AD4913 NOTE:  Sir William Earle Welby (1734-1815) was a landowner and Member of Parliament for Grantham in Lincolnshire, from 1802-1806.  He had previously been created a Baronet in 1801. The agate stone has been finely carved with an arm holding a sword over fire. After 1806 he retired from public life until his death in 1815. He was succeeded in his title by his eldest son, Lieutenant Sir William Earle Welby 2nd Baronet (1768-1852). Further details: good- intaglio intact, minor wear commensurate with age  A Cubit Arm In Armour Issuing From Clouds Ppr., Holding A Sword Arg., Pommel And Hilt Or, Over Flames Of Fire, Also Ppr., Issuant From The Wreath
